Property description Presenting this spacious four-bedroom end-of-terrace Victorian house, arranged over four floors available to let. The property is in good condition and offers ample living space, making it ideal for families or professional couples seeking a comfortable and convenient home.
The spacious reception room features large windows, providing an abundance of natural light and highlighting the generous proportions of the room-perfect for relaxing or entertaining guests. The open-plan kitchen is equipped with a gas cooker, fridge-freezer, and washing machine, as well as designated dining space for family meals.
Upstairs, the first-floor landing benefits from a built-in storage cupboard, enhancing the practicality of the home. The accommodation includes two sizeable double bedrooms, with the master bedroom and a further single bedroom-boasting a Velux window-both situated on the second floor. Additional built-in storage can be found in one of the double bedrooms, ensuring comfort and organisation.
The family bathroom is fitted with a classic three-piece suite, featuring a free-standing bath and a shower over the bath. The large cellar offers further storage or potential workspace, while a small yard to the front, soon to be fenced for added privacy, provides outdoor space.
Conveniently located close to public transport links, reputable schools, local amenities, and nearby parks, this property also benefits from an EPC rating of D and falls within council tax band A. This delightful home combines Victorian character with modern living, making it a must view.
